skate journal: garage tres on the putter that made me happy (jan 17, 2017 day 9)

Went into the garage feeling pretty lazy. Was on my regular board, but ended up hating it. I did get a bit into my normal list. Kickflips, fakie flip, halfcab flip, b/s flip. But then I grabbed my putter and things got way more fun. Got a frontside flip right away. And a quick heelflip. I’ve only landed a couple since moving up in board size so that was a treat. Then I got into a groove of nollie flip or treflip. Never got a nollie flip, but the last of three treflips felt great. I haven’t done one like that in a long time. It’s been huck and pray. Needless to say I will most likely be switching back to a smaller setup.

(setup normal 8.25 setup with 5.8s then the putter 7.5″ for the goods)
